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[php] [sql] Data aktualizacji bazy SQL
magier123
post 16.04.2007, 08:51:29
Post #1





Grupa: Zarejestrowani
Postów: 80
Pomógł: 0
Dołączył: 27.03.2007

Ostrzeżenie: (0%)
-----


Czy wie ktos moze jaki skrypt wyswietlalby o godzine i date ostatnich zmian w bazie SQL?
Go to the top of the page
+Quote Post
Kosmi
post 16.04.2007, 09:25:59
Post #2





Grupa: Zarejestrowani
Postów: 23
Pomógł: 0
Dołączył: 24.07.2006

Ostrzeżenie: (0%)
-----


Jeżeli baza MySQL to można poprzez zapytanie:

  1. SHOW TABLE STATUS FROM nazwa_bazy


Z wierszy wyników (jeżeli jest kilka tabel) wystarczy wybrać najnowszą datę w polu Update_time poprzez sortowanie, pętlę czy dowolną inną metodę.

Pozdrawiam
Kosmi


--------------------
Elektrotechnika z Informatyką Techniczną. Studia w Lesznie!
Go to the top of the page
+Quote Post
magier123
post 16.04.2007, 09:40:57
Post #3





Grupa: Zarejestrowani
Postów: 80
Pomógł: 0
Dołączył: 27.03.2007

Ostrzeżenie: (0%)
-----


  1. <?
  2. $mod = ("SHOW TABLE STATUS;");
  3. $wynik = mysql_query ($mod);
  4.  
  5. if ($wynik) {
  6. echo ("<table border="0" cellpadding="5" class="text_12">
  7. <tr><td>nazwa</td><td>wpisów</td>
  8. <td>data ostat. modyfikacji</td></tr>");
  9. while($dane = mysql_fetch_array($wynik)) {
  10. if (eregi(" cennik_towary|cennik_magazyn|cennik_jednostki|cennik_marki|cennik_kategori
    e|cenn
  11. ik_podatek",$dane["Name"])) {
  12. echo "<tr>";
  13. echo "<td>".$dane["Name"]."</td>";
  14. echo "<td>".$dane["Rows"]."</td>";
  15. echo "<td>".$dane["Update_time"]."</td>";
  16. }
  17. }
  18. echo "</table>";
  19. }
  20. ?>



Dzieki za pomoc KOSMI.... powyzej podaje kod jaki mozna zastosowac.... snitch.gif
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 19.07.2025 - 07:35